Output 21abbdfffe6d93dd1c5d6a5e0006c7b42301c85525790a0921fd9f1d3f8051a1:4

value
42021587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7dfca240e17e0073f6b905badbdee077e52278 OP_EQUAL
address
MEscWjF8ijUhT3gscT1p1LJZE2v6jiZJi1
transaction
21abbdfffe6d93dd1c5d6a5e0006c7b42301c85525790a0921fd9f1d3f8051a1
spent
true